Repeated playback

You can repeatedly listen to a favorite track or disc.
Select the "CD" input.
Setup for repeating a single track
1 Confirm that the "PGM" indi-
cator is not lit.
(If the "PGM" indicator is lit,
press the PGM key to turn it
off.)
2 Select "REPEAT".
Setup for repeating all tracks in a disc
1 Confirm that the "PGM" indi-
cator is not lit.
(If the "PGM" indicator is lit,
press the PGM key to turn it
off.)
2 Select "REPEAT ALL".
Setup for repeating selected tracks
1 Program the track sequence
according to steps 1 to 2 of
"Listening in the desired se-
quence".
2 Select "REPEAT".

To stop repeated playback
Press the REPEAT key repeatedly until the
repeat mode is switched off.
÷ The "REPEAT" or "REPEAL ALL" indicator turns off
and playback according to the current CD player
mode starts.
